The XC4036XL-3HQ240C is a versatile field-programmable gate array (FPGA) from Xilinx’s XC4000XL series, designed to deliver exceptional performance for complex digital system implementations. This advanced programmable logic device combines high-speed operation with flexible configuration options, making it an ideal choice for demanding applications in telecommunications, industrial automation, and embedded systems.
Product Specifications
The XC4036XL-3HQ240C features a robust architecture built on proven FPGA technology. This device incorporates 36,000 system gates with a speed grade of -3, ensuring optimal performance for time-critical applications. The component utilizes a 240-pin plastic quad flat pack (PQFP) package in the HQ240 configuration, providing excellent thermal characteristics and reliable electrical connections.
Key technical specifications include advanced input/output capabilities with support for multiple voltage standards, internal clock management resources, and dedicated routing architecture. The XC4036XL-3HQ240C operates across commercial temperature ranges and offers extensive configuration memory for complex logic implementations. The device supports both boundary scan testing and in-system programming, enhancing design flexibility and manufacturing efficiency.
Power consumption characteristics are optimized for both active and standby modes, making the XC4036XL-3HQ240C suitable for power-sensitive applications. The device includes built-in configuration options and supports various programming methods, including serial and parallel configuration modes.
